What to Say in Follow-Up Sessions (So Clients Keep Coming Back)
from Dietitian Boss with Libby Rothschild · host Libby Rothschild
In this episode, learn how to effectively retain clients and lead impactful follow-up sessions with a three-step structure from the Dietitian Boss library. Discover why repeating intakes can be a pitfall, how using specific language fosters client buy-in, and the importance of providing a clear reason for clients to return.
